M-Ratings: Phones rated M3 or M4 meet FCC
requirements and are likely to generate less
interference to hearing devices than phones that
are not labeled. M4 is the better/higher of the two
ratings.
T-Ratings: Phones rated T3 or T4 meet FCC
requirements and are likely to be more usable with
a hearing device's telecoil ("T Switch" or
"Telephone Switch") than unrated phones. T4 is the
better/ higher of the two ratings. (Note that not all
hearing devices contain telecoils.)
Your Z6530V has been tested for hearing aid
device compatibility and has an M4/T4 rating.
Hearing devices may also be measured for
immunity to this type of interference. Your hearing
device manufacturer or hearing health professional
may help you find results for your hearing device.
For additional information about the FCC's actions
with regard to hearing aid compatible wireless
devices and other steps the FCC has taken to
ensure that individuals with disabilities have access
to telecommunications services, please go to
www.fcc.gov/cgb/dro.
